Browse Source

drivers/media: Add export.h for EXPORT_SYMBOL/THIS_MODULE as required

These two macros were in module.h but now module.h is no longer
sprayed across every source file imaginable, so the users need
to expicitly call out their use of them.

Signed-off-by: Paul Gortmaker <paul.gortmaker@windriver.com>
Paul Gortmaker 14 years ago
parent
commit
35a246363e

+ 1 - 0
drivers/media/common/saa7146_hlp.c

@@ -1,4 +1,5 @@
 #include <linux/kernel.h>
+#include <linux/export.h>
 #include <media/saa7146_vv.h>
 
 static void calculate_output_format_register(struct saa7146_dev* saa, u32 palette, u32* clip_format)

+ 1 - 0
drivers/media/dvb/siano/smsendian.c

@@ -19,6 +19,7 @@
 
  ****************************************************************/
 
+#include <linux/export.h>
 #include <asm/byteorder.h>
 
 #include "smsendian.h"

+ 1 - 0
drivers/media/media-device.c

@@ -23,6 +23,7 @@
 #include <linux/types.h>
 #include <linux/ioctl.h>
 #include <linux/media.h>
+#include <linux/export.h>
 
 #include <media/media-device.h>
 #include <media/media-devnode.h>

+ 2 - 0
drivers/media/radio/wl128x/fmdrv_v4l2.c

@@ -28,6 +28,8 @@
  *
  */
 
+#include <linux/export.h>
+
 #include "fmdrv.h"
 #include "fmdrv_v4l2.h"
 #include "fmdrv_common.h"

+ 1 - 0
drivers/media/rc/ir-raw.c

@@ -12,6 +12,7 @@
  *  GNU General Public License for more details.
  */
 
+#include <linux/export.h>
 #include <linux/kthread.h>
 #include <linux/mutex.h>
 #include <linux/kmod.h>

+ 1 - 0
drivers/media/video/hdpvr/hdpvr-i2c.c

@@ -17,6 +17,7 @@
 
 #include <linux/i2c.h>
 #include <linux/slab.h>
+#include <linux/export.h>
 
 #include "hdpvr.h"
 

+ 1 - 0
drivers/media/video/v4l2-ctrls.c

@@ -20,6 +20,7 @@
 
 #include <linux/ctype.h>
 #include <linux/slab.h>
+#include <linux/export.h>
 #include <media/v4l2-ioctl.h>
 #include <media/v4l2-device.h>
 #include <media/v4l2-ctrls.h>

+ 1 - 0
drivers/media/video/v4l2-event.c

@@ -29,6 +29,7 @@
 
 #include <linux/sched.h>
 #include <linux/slab.h>
+#include <linux/export.h>
 
 static unsigned sev_pos(const struct v4l2_subscribed_event *sev, unsigned idx)
 {

+ 1 - 0
drivers/media/video/v4l2-fh.c

@@ -24,6 +24,7 @@
 
 #include <linux/bitops.h>
 #include <linux/slab.h>
+#include <linux/export.h>
 #include <media/v4l2-dev.h>
 #include <media/v4l2-fh.h>
 #include <media/v4l2-event.h>

+ 1 - 0
drivers/media/video/v4l2-subdev.c

@@ -24,6 +24,7 @@
 #include <linux/slab.h>
 #include <linux/types.h>
 #include <linux/videodev2.h>
+#include <linux/export.h>
 
 #include <media/v4l2-ctrls.h>
 #include <media/v4l2-device.h>